Agatha Merritt was born on February 11, 1711 in Scituate, Plymouth, Massachusetts, daughter of Thomas Merritt (~1685–1724) and Abigail Woodworth (1685–1736).[1][2]
Agatha (18) married Clement Bates (22) (born on December 27, 1707 in Scituate, Massachusetts Bay; son of Joseph Bates and Anna (Sylvester) Bates) on June 15, 1730 in Hanover, Plymouth, Province of Massachusetts Bay.[3]
Agatha died on December 25, 1786 in Hanover, Plymouth, Massachusetts, United States, aged 74.[4]
